NUA-EABHRAC – Aibreán 23, 2018Combate Americas today announced an epic, Martial Arts Measctha beo (MMA) event that will feature fighters representing Mexico against combatants representing the U.S., beginning with a much-anticipated women’s atomweight (105 punt) matchup pitting world ranked stars Lisbeth “Coneja” Lopez Silva (5-3) agus Kyra "Mogwai" Batara (7-4) against one another, at McClellan Conference Center in Sacramento, Calif. ar an Aoine, Bealtaine 11.
 

Also announced today for “Combate Americas: Mexico vs. USA” was a featherweight (145 punt) co-main event between Horacio “The Punisher” Gutierrez (4-3) agus Nate Diaz cosanta Chris Avila (5-6).

 

Phraghas ó $40, ticéid do “Combate Americas: Mexico vs. USA” are on sale atTicketon.com.

 

“’Mexico vs. USA is the best of Combate Americas, with ‘soccer style,’ country vs. country competition,"A dúirt Combate Americas POF Campbell McLaren. “Lisbeth and Kyra are the top two atomweights in the world, and there is going to be an atomic explosion when these atoms collide.”

 

Ranked as high as 20 in the world in the women’s atomweight division, Lopez Silva, a 21-year-old native of Mexico City, Mexico is aiming for her sixth straight victory after defeating Sheila Padilla of the U.S. by way of TKO (punches) sa dara babhta (3:24) of their bout at the inaugural “COPA COMBATE” extravaganza in Cancun last November 11.

 

Lopez Silva recently joined forces with the Guadalajara, Mexico-based Team Grasso, the home of MMA superstars Alexa Grasso agus Irene Aldana.

 

The 23-year-old Batara, who fights out of Las Vegas, Nev. and is ranked as high as 19 sa domhan, is coming off her second consecutive win, a unanimous decision over long-standing rival Paulina “Firefox” Granados in the main event of “Combate Americas: Queen Warriors” last December 1.

 

Roimhe sin, Dia, a grappling expert schooled by famed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u master Eddie Bravo, defeated 12-time national Judo champion Vanesa Rico of Spain via second round (3:46) aighneacht (armbar).

 

Gutierrez is an aggressive-minded, 27-bliain d'aois, rising star out of Guadalajara, aiming to make noise in what will be his Combate Americas promotional debut.

 

In his last effort on May 12, 2017, Gutierrez scored a first round (2:37) knockout (Punch) ar Antonio Suarez.

 

Representing the U.S., the 25-year-old Avila fights out of Lodi, Calif. is looking to return to his past form that saw him notch victories in five of his first seven professional starts, four of which came by way of (T)KO or submission inside of two rounds.

LOS ANGELES – On Friday, Iúil 13, Julia Budd (11-2) will defend her featherweight world title against Brazilian jiu-jitsu ace Talita Nogueira (7-0), i gcás is mó de Bellator 202 at WinStar World Casino and Resort. Chomh maith leis sin, the co-headliner will feature former Bellator world champion Eduardo Dantas (20-5) ag cur ar Michael McDonald (18-4) in a bantamweight clash of top contenders.

 

Bellator 202: Budd vs. Walnut will be broadcast live and free on Paramount Network at 9 p.m. ET / 8 p.m. CT, while preliminary action will stream on Bellator.comand globally on the Bellator Mobile App. Tickets for the event go on sale this Friday, Aibreán 20 and can be purchased at the WinStar World Casino and Resort box office, as well as through Ticketmaster and Bellator.com. Beidh bouts breise a fógraíodh sna seachtainí atá romhainn.

 

 

 

Julia Budd, the only fighter to sit atop Bellator women’s featherweight division, has bested Germaine de Randamie, Arlene Blencowe agus Marloes Coenen amongst other names over the course of her eight-year mixed martial arts career. “The Jewel” is also the only woman to defeat Gina Carano in Muay-Thai competition. Anois, the Canada-native and former STRIKEFORCE competitor, returns to Oklahoma, where she makes her second title defense since winning the belt last year at Bellator 174.

 

 

 

Talita Nogueira had already been crowned a world champion in jiu-jitsu prior to testing her hand in MMA. “Treta” went undefeated in six MMA contests in her home town of Sao Paulo, Brazil between 2009 agus 2013, before signing to compete with Bellator. Originally slated to fight Budd at Bellator 133, Nogueira suffered an injury that forced her to withdraw from the contest. Her highly-anticipated promotional debut ultimately took place at Bellator 182, where the 32-year-old scored a first-round submission over Amanda Bell. The Demain Maia-trained fighter now gets a second chance to compete against Budd, and this time, the world championship is on the line.

 

 

 

Former two-time world champion Eduardo “Dudu” Dantas has proven himself a perennial top-10 bantamweight fighter with impressive performances over Joe Warren, Marcos Galvao (x2), Wilson Reis and Zach Makovsky. An Séasúr Bellator 5 tournament champion has strung together an impressive 10-2 record with Bellator during his seven-year tenure with the promotion. The 29-year-old trains alongside the likes of Jose Aldo at the famed Nova Uniao team in his home town of Rio de Janeiro and is looking for another shot at Bellator gold.

 

 

 

Fighting professionally since the age of 16, McDonald has been a mainstay in the bantamweight rankings for the better part of 11 bliana. The exciting Brazilian jiu-jitsu black belt has amassed an astonishing finishing rate, reaching the judges’ scorecards only three times in his 22 troideanna. “Mayday” made his Bellator debut in 2017, scoring a victory over Peter Ligier, despite fracturing his hand early in the fight. Now that his hand has fully healed, the former world title challenger from Modesto, Calif. will look to defeat Dantas July 13 on Paramount Network.

Portland, Maine (Aibreán 23, 2018) - Troideanna Sasana Nua (NEF) returns to Aura in Portland, Maine lena chéad imeacht ealaíona comhraic measctha eile, “NEF 34: Home of the Brave,” ar an Satharn oíche, Meitheamh 16, 2018. Níos luaithe inniu, the fight promotion announced the addition of a professional light-heavyweight bout to the card. Mike “An Mustache” Hansen (5-9) sceidealta chun freastal ar Buck “Knuckles” Pineau (1-5) ag troid meáchan de 205-punt.

Mike Hansen, a veteran combat engineer with the US Army and former state wrestling champion out of Mountain Valley High School in Rumford, Maine, will look to get back on the winning track after five straight losses in the MMA cage. His last victory was in the fall of 2016 when Hansen handed Matt Andrikut (2-1) his first taste of defeat as a professional. He is determined to snap his losing streak on Meitheamh 16 in Portland against Pineau. Hansen is a founding member of Berserkers MMA based in Rumford.

“Tá mé ar bís a fháil ar ais sa Cage,” said Hansen. “I had to take some time off to let some injuries heal and coach the wrestling team. Now that that’s done, it’s time to get back at it. I’m happy to fight a guy like Buck. I know we have both been on a rough patch and lost some fights, but by the end of the night on June 16th, someone’s losing streak will end. I’m going to make sure I leave with a win in June.

Ar Meitheamh 16 it will have been 45 mhí – nearly four yearssince Buck Pineau last competed in the NEF cage. Pineau was a staple on early NEF cards. From the company’s inception in February 2012 go dtí go “NEF 14” i mí Mheán Fómhair 2014, Pineau fought on a total of eight NEF events. Ag “NEF 9” i Biddeford, Maine, he fought in what is regarded as one of the most memorable bouts in the promotion’s history, tearing ligaments in his knee early in the fight but still pulling out a unanimous decision victory over Isaiah Queen (2-4). Despite staying active in recent years outside of Maine, Pineau has never competed in the NEF cage as a professional. He has lost his last four-in-a-row, and like Hansen, is looking to get back on track with a much-needed win atNEF 34.Pineau is currently a member of First Class MMA based in Topsham, Maine.

SAINT PETERSBURG, Rúis (Aibreán 19, 2018)) – M-1 Domhanda, in association with WKG, has announced anundisputedtitle bout May 12 do na M-1 Dúshlán 91 imeacht is mó, pitting M-1 Challenge flyweight champion Aleksander Doskalchuk and Interim titlist Arman Ashimov, in Shenzhen, An tSín.

 

M-1 Dúshlán 91 will be live-streamed from China in high definition onwww.M1Global.TV. Beidh Amharcáin in ann féachaint ar na troideanna réamh-agus is mó cártaí trí logáil isteach ar chlárú ar www.M1Global.TV. Is féidir le lucht leanúna féachaint ar an gníomh ar a gcuid ríomhairí, chomh maith le ar Android agus Apple fóin cliste agus táibléad. M-1 Dúshlán 91 will also be available onwww.FITE.TV(preliminary card is free, $7.99 for the main card)

 

 

 

The originally scheduled M-1 Dúshlán 91, Aibreán 21 in Saint Petersburg, featured M-1 Challenge featherweight champion Khamzat Dalgiev against American challenger NateThe TrainLandwehr, has been cancelled. Dalgiev vs. Landwehr will be rescheduled during 2018.

 

 

 

Doskalchuk (8-1-0, M-1: 2-0-0), troid as an Úcráin, won his title belt last September at M-1 Dúshlán 83, when he used a Guillotine Choke to submit Vadim Malygin sa dara babhta.

 

 

 

Undefeated in M-1 competition, Doskalchuk won a majority decision in his M-1 debut last May, níos mó Binh Son Le ag M-1 Dúshlán 78.

 

 

 

I don’t care if my opponent has a belt or not,” Doskalchuk said. “The main thing is to properly prepare for the fight to determine the real flyweight champion. I am not expecting this fight to be easy. It’s going to be a tough battle and I will be looking for an opportunity to finish off my opponent. Fans will see a great fight. How will it end? We’ll see at The Rage!”

 

 

 

Ashimov (8-2-1, M-1: 3-0-0) earned his Interim title shot this past February by stopping Gadzhimurad Aliev agus Ervani Melonio with punches, faoi ​​seach, in the second and first rounds. Ag M-1 Dúshlán 87, the powerfully striking Kazakh punched out Mikael Silander in two rounds to capture the M-1 Challenge Interim Flyweight Championship.

 

 

 

All of Kazakhstan is waiting for this fight,” Ashimov noted. “I can’t wait because I brought the Interim belt to Kazakhstan and, if God wills, soon I will bring back the undisputed title. I’m fighting a strong and experienced opponent, who I respect a lot, but I will be ready and that will show fight night. ”

 

 

The co-feature is a middleweight showdown between veteran Russian fighter Mikhail Zayats (23-8-0, M-1: 13-5-0) and past M-1 Challenge middleweight title challenger CaioHellboy” Magalhaes (10-4-0, M-1: 1-1-0), na Brasaíle. Zayats has fought in Bellator, Magalhaes in the UFC. Last October, Magalhaes lost his M-1 Challenge middleweight title challenge to champion Artem Frolov by way of a five-round unanimous decision, headlining M-1 Dúshlán 84.

 

 

 

One other main card fight was announced featuring one of China’s top MMA fighters, MusuIron KingNuertiebieke (12-2-0, M-1: 0-1-0) versus American featherweight Daniel Swain (17-8-1, M-1: 0-0-1).

NUA-EABHRAC – Aibreán 18, 2018Combate Americas today announced a live Univision Deportes Network (UDN) telecast, as well as the complete 10-bout fight card for theCombate Estrellas II” Martial Arts Measctha (MMA) extravaganza at Gimnasio Nuevo Leon in Monterrey, Mexico on Friday, Aibreán 20.

 

An beo, 90-minute UDN telecast of “Combate Estrellas II,” which will be headlined by a previously announced, highly-anticipated bantamweight (135 punt) rematch between world-ranked superstar and Monterrey native Erik “Goyito” Perez (17-6), and hard-hitting finisher David “D.J.Fuentes (13-10) of the U.S., Tosaíonn ag 12 a.m. AGUS / 9 p.m. PT, and will follow the live stream of Combate Americas’ preliminary bout card, ag tosú ag 8 p.m. ET / 5 p.m. PT, on UnivisionDeportes.com.

 

Fuentes, who fights out of McAllen, Texas, defeated Perez by way of third round (3:01) aighneacht (armlock) when the two met on May 28, 2010.

 

In a new bantamweight (135 punt) comh-príomh imeacht, Victor “Periquito” Madrigal (6-1) de Guadalajara, Mexico, will replace “COPA COMBATE” tournament winner Tobhach Saul Marroquin de Monterrey, Mexico, who has withdrawn due to illness, against fellow fast-rising star Alejandro “Gallito” Flores (11-1) de Monterrey.

 

Leading off the three-bout, live televised main card, undefeated strawweight (115 punt) ealaíontóir knockout Melissa “Super Mely” Martinez (3-0) de gCathair Mheicsiceo, Mexico, will collide with fellow, hard-hitting Muay Thai stylist Ivanna Martinenghi (4-1) de Buenos Aires, An Airgintín.

 

Martinez was originally slated to face Francis Hernandez of Puerto Rico.

 

In other action announced for Combate Estrellas II,” prolific finisher Marcelo “PitBull” Rojo (13-5) of Cordoba, An Airgintín, Beidh cearnach amach le Fabian Galvan (8-3) of Monterrey in a bantamweight contest.

EnriqueLocote” Gonzalez (6-1) of Monterrey will collide with Oscar Suarez (4-1) of Santa Cruz Tenerife, Spáinn, in a bantamweight tilt.

Jose Luis “El PistoleroMedrano (5-2) of Monterrey will battle Daniel “Boy Golden” Zellhuber (5-0) de gCathair Mheicsiceo.

 

Also in the card, Mexican Muay Thai fighter Lezly Hinojosa Compean (0-0) will make her debut under the MMA rules against Spanish superstar Irene Cabello Rivera (7-5) of Barcelona, Spain in an atomweight (105 punt) deireadh.

Portland, Maine (Aibreán 18, 2018) - Troideanna Sasana Nua (NEF) returns to Aura in Portland, Maine lena chéad imeacht ealaíona comhraic measctha eile, “NEF 34: Home of the Brave,” ar an Satharn oíche, Meitheamh 16, 2018. Níos luaithe inniu, the fight promotion officially announced a professional featherweight bout for the card. Aaron “Gan staonadh” Lacey (5-1) sceidealta chun aghaidh Da’MonThe DiamondBlackshear (4-1).

After suffering the first loss of his professional career in late 2017 – a doctor stoppage due to a cut on his head during a bout in New HampshireLacey bounced back this past February with a big victory atNEF 32” i Lewiston, Maine. He came out aggressive in the first round against veteran Josh Parker (6-10), forcing Parker to tap late in the first-round to a rear-naked choke. And while it certainly was an impressive win for the 2016 NEF Fighter of the Year and product of Young’s MMA, Lacey felt that he had more to showcase for his fans. He will get the opportunity again on Meitheamh 16 against Blackshear.

“It’s time once again to do what I love in front of the fans that I love,” said Lacey. “My last fight was really quick, and I didn’t get to showcase what I have been working on. Although I’m always going for the finish, I will be looking to put on an entertaining show that fans will not soon forget!"

Based out of Fayetteville, North Carolina, Da’Mon Blackshear began his MMA career in the fall of 2014. He put together a stellar amateur record of 7-1, capturing two championships in the southeastern region of the country. Upon turning professional, Blackshear, a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u purple belt, has taken three of his four pro victories by way of submission. He has earned gold in numerous submission-only grappling events, regularly defeating black belts and larger opponents. Blackshear serves as a coach of Team R.O.C. in Fayetteville.

Portland, Maine (Aibreán 15, 2018) - Troideanna Sasana Nua (NEF) made its return to Portland on Saturday night with the fight promotion’s latest mixed-martial-arts event, “NEF 33: Riptide.For the second time in as many events at the venue, NEF packed Aura with a sold-out crowd.

On the amateur portion of the card, Kam Arnold (3-0) continued his winning ways with a highlight-reel, one-punch knockout of David Thompson (1-3). Arnold, a hot prospect out of Central Maine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u in nearby Lewiston, Maine, dropped Thompson with a right hand in the first round to remain undefeated.

Walt Shea (3-1) agus Nate Boucher (2-3) met in the amateur headliner at a catchweight of 130-pounds. Both athletes were looking to bounce back from losses in their last respective NEF appearances, but it was Shea who took the victory late in the third round when referee Kevin MacDonald stopped the fight due to strikes. Earlier in the evening, Shea’s First Class MMA teammate, Ben Murtiff (1-0) won his amateur debut, making for a perfect 2-0 night for the Topsham, Maine-based team.

On the professional side of the card, Ernesto Ornelas (3-7) picked up the win over Carl Langston (0-1) trí chinneadh d'aon toil. Chuimhneacháin ina dhiaidh sin, Ornelas’s teammate at the Choi Institute Caleb Hall (1-0) was successful in his pro debut with a first-round submission of veteran John Ortolani (8-13).

The main event of the evening saw longtime Maine MMA veteran Bill Jones (13-11) defeat Matt Denning (5-8) via technical knockout in the second round. Denning announced his retirement from cage competition immediately following the bout. Jones’ win capped a successful night for Nostos MMA of Somersworth, New Hampshire. The team went 3-0 ar an oíche le Zac Risteard (1-0) agus Killian Murphy (1-0) taking home wins on the amateur card.

NEF announced that its next mixed-martial-arts event, “NEF 34: Home of the Bravewould take place back at Aura in Portland onMeitheamh 16, 2018. Already announced for that card, Ross Dannar (1-1) agus Devin Corson (1-1) will square off in an amateur lightweight contest, cé go Aaron Lacey (5-1) returns to the NEF cage to take on Da’mon Blackshear (4-1) in a professional featherweight bout.
